Motorists can avoid the most common MOT failure affecting highway customers throughout the UK by finishing up one fast repair, in accordance to consultants. MOT specialists at Fixter have claimed that changing any flickering or uninteresting headlights was very important to staying protected behind the wheel.

According to information from the RAC, points round lighting and signaling had been the most common motive vehicles fail their annual DVSA MOT examination. Data exhibits that just about a fifth of all vehicles (18.9%) that fail their MOT achieve this as a result of of an difficulty with their car lights. Even one thing so simple as a blown bulb will be enough for examiners to fail a vehicle. 

Fixter confused that going round and making sure lights are all working forward of an examination was essential. However, changing any defective or broken bulbs was a should forward of assessments to guarantee highway customers keep on the proper aspect of the guidelines. 

Fixter defined: “To stay safe, carry out a weekly check on all lights, including fog and number plate bulbs, and replace any that are flickering or dull. Fixter experts suggest parking close to a wall and using the light reflection to check that beams are working properly.”

Car headlights are important as they enable motorists to see the highway forward in the darkish or during poor climate. Similarly, headlights are additionally essential to make your vehicle noticeable to different drivers, pedestrians, and cyclists utilizing the highway. 

Headlights are a legal requirement, which means motorists should make sure they’re working earlier than getting behind the wheel.

The RAC added: “Do the indicators flash as they should? Do the sidelights and fog lights function as they should? Don’t forget the number plate lights. It’s also worth checking the condition of the lights. Often plastic lenses get misty over time, so it might be worth buying a kit to clean your lights ahead of the MOT.

“Look out for any cracks in your lights, too, and ask someone to stand behind the vehicle to check the brake lights light up as you press the brake pedal.”

Fixter added that motorists must also make sure the very important elements are working earlier than heading for an MOT. These embrace trying over the car’s dashboard warning lights, brakes, tyres and windscreen wipers.
